Ourusualbeach Posted September 1, 2019 #1 Share Posted September 1, 2019 Royal has changed the deck plans on Oasis. What was to be all cabins in the old D lounge on decks 11 and 12 has now been changed to now being a card room on both decks where the 3 center cabins were initially shown. There was a lot of speculation about those 3 center cabins as they appeared much larger than a regular inside.
